[ad_1] HELSINKI: US President Donald Trump visited the summit with Vladimir Putin on Monday, determined to overcome diplomatic tensions and forge a personal connection with the Kremlin leader . Trump's Instinct Checks …
Read More »[ad_1] HELSINKI: US President Donald Trump visited the summit with Vladimir Putin on Monday, determined to overcome diplomatic tensions and forge a personal connection with the Kremlin leader . Trump's Instinct Checks …
Read More »